Santa’s Sleigh Returns to Thame THIS WEEKEND!

5th December 2025

Thame & District Round Table has announced the launch of its first Santa Sleigh run of the 2025 season, taking place on Saturday 6 December, between 4pm and 8pm.

Residents will be able to follow Santa’s progress each evening from 6–14 December using the official online tracker, available at trt.fyi/santa.

Organisers have confirmed that some of the traditional routes have been updated this year to ensure coverage of Thame’s growing residential areas. Full route information and daily updates will be published online via the Santa tracker link and through the Round Table’s social media channels.

The sleigh is scheduled to visit the following roads on Saturday:
Roman Way, Sycamore Drive, Cedar Crescent, Old Union Way, Southern Road, Hollier’s Close, Coombe Hill Crescent, Arnold Way, Broadwaters Avenue, Van Diemen’s Road, Corbet Way, Windmill Road and Nelson Street.

Volunteers will be collecting donations throughout the run. Both cash and card payments will be accepted, with all funds raised shared among the local charity groups supporting this year’s collection efforts. Online donations can also be made at trt.fyi/donate.

In a statement from “North Pole HQ,” organisers noted that while the team works hard to ensure Santa is visible to as many families as possible, the sleigh run depends on volunteers giving up their time. Residents are encouraged to use the live tracker to find the best opportunity to see Santa during his visits to the town.

You are warmly invited to attend Death Cafe in Thame. at 7:30pm in room 1 of the Barns Centre, and held on the third Thursday of each month thereafter A Death Cafe is an informal gathering where people can discuss death over tea and cake. We’re aiming to normalise the topic of death, raise acceptance, and help people make the most of their lives by breaking the taboo around mortality. It is not a grief support group or counselling session. These sessions have no agenda, objectives, or themes, allowing for organic, group-directed conversations about anything related to death, from end-of-life planning to fears and feelings, fostering open sharing in a respectful, confidential space.
